What Banks Are Available in Belize
The Belizean banking sector is relatively small, by western standards, but they do definitely provide a full range of services to support the offshore sector. You can expect to be able to access everything from general banking and transaction accounts, international and trade services, and wealth management. In short, most of the banks in Belize cater very strongly to the offshore sector and are absolutely used to dealing with onshore and offshore companies and trust structures.
Institutions That Will Allow You to Open Belize Bank Account Online
Caye International Bank Limited
Caye International Bank provides an excellent offering for offshore companies and is a full-service banking operation. To their credit, they also offer a gold loan program which is quite attractive and unique in the region. Their management team possesses extensive experience in the offshore world and is a great resource when you need a little help or advice on your banking options.
- Minimum Deposit – US$1,000
- Normal KYC Documents and checks required
- Application Fee of: US$100
- FATCA Fee of: US$250 (only for US persons)

Belize Bank
Belize Bank is also a good option and provides a full range of banking and commercial services. They are one of the bigger banks in the country and have a very strong reputation for service. I would say they are definitely less of a “boutique” bank and, therefore, the general services are less bespoke. They actively operate in the offshore banking sector and are well versed in remote account openings. However, at the time of writing, they are unable to offer you either a Debit or Credit Card.
- Minimum Deposit: US$4,000
- Normal KYC Documents Required
- Application Fee: circa US$100
- FATCA Fee: US$250 (Only for US Persons)

Heritage Bank
Heritage Bank was formed in 1999 in response to a perceived need for more generalized offshore banking options in the Central American country. The bank was conceived initially from a merger between two local banking institutions with common shareholders. The bank offers general international services including on-demand accounts and commercial loans. Standard Mastercards are available for account holders and require a US$1,000 minimum block.
- Minimum Deposit: US$3,000
- Normal KYC Documents Required

What Documents Will I Need
As mentioned, there has been a greater move towards AML and KYC compliance over the past few years and Belizean banks have definitely taken the track of requiring more documentation. At the minimum you will be required to provide the following documentation for a corporate/business account:
- Application Form
- Signed Bank Mandate
- Certified Extract of a Board Meeting authorizing the account opening
- Notarized Company Documents including, a certificate of incorporation, Articles of Association, Subscribers Agreement, Letter of Undertaking, Certificate of Shareholders, or Corporate Extract.
- Potentially, certified copies of your latest financial statements
- Website Details and Full Business Details
- Source of Funds Declaration
- Notarized identity documents and proof of address (not older than 3 months)
Can I Open the Bank Account Remotely
Thankfully, most Belizean Banks do not insist upon an in-person visit for the opening of a business or corporate account. This is primarily why the list of notarized documentation is quite extensive. The primary reason is that they are protecting themselves, through the KYC process, and relying upon the Notary to certify your documents.
Subsequently, as long as you can provide most of your corporate documents, in a notarized form, proof of address, and your passport copy, you will be able to open an account remotely. In some cases, they may require a video/skype call with you to match you against your passport. Ultimately, it’s a fairly seamless process when you have gathered all of the documentation together.
